Transaction 6a597a4786af5877133fd764a3d403e3a442353c785d14894e4eb7e4178fbc6d
1 Input
1 Output
-
6a597a4786af5877133fd764a3d403e3a442353c785d14894e4eb7e4178fbc6d:0
- value
- 51196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 718f064bc54009481c9d0c56436e71cb5e143ad5 OP_EQUAL
- address
- 3C3Tck5eBp8zqapyCSMnUyEYCrYD5FncqK